推荐项目:Gradle依赖格式化插件

推荐项目:Gradle依赖格式化插件

idea-gradle-dependencies-formatterGradle dependencies formatter for IntelliJ IDEA项目地址:https://gitcode.com/gh_mirrors/id/idea-gradle-dependencies-formatter

Gradle dependencies formatter Logo

在Java开发领域,尤其是使用Gradle作为构建工具的项目中,管理依赖关系是一项基础而重要的任务。Gradle依赖格式化插件正是为简化这一过程而生,它专为IntelliJ IDEA用户设计,提供了一套高效、便捷的方式来处理Gradle文件中的依赖项。

项目介绍

Gradle dependencies formatter是一个强大的IntelliJ IDEA插件,旨在自动化和优化Gradle脚本中依赖关系的管理和格式化。通过一系列智能化的功能,该插件让开发者能够轻松地在字符串表示和映射表示之间转换依赖项,自动排序依赖,以及直接将Maven依赖转换成Gradle兼容形式,极大地提升了开发效率和代码可读性。

项目技术分析

该项目基于IntelliJ IDEA的插件开发框架,利用了Gradle的灵活性和IntelliJ的高级API来实现其功能。它覆盖了代码意图行动、自定义动作以及文本处理等多个方面,确保在处理依赖时既能保持高度的自动化,又能保证用户有选择转换格式的自由。特别是在版本控制和团队协作中,统一的依赖格式对于维护代码质量至关重要。

项目及技术应用场景

适用于所有使用Gradle作为构建工具,并依赖于IntelliJ IDEA进行开发的Java或Kotlin项目。尤其适合大型项目或有着复杂依赖管理需求的团队,因为它能显著减少手动格式化的错误,加快迭代速度。例如,在多人协作的环境中,确保所有的依赖以一致的方式添加至build.gradle文件,可以避免合并冲突,提高代码审查的效率。

项目特点

  1. 双向转换:支持在简洁的字符串格式和易读的映射格式之间轻松切换,适应不同的编码风格和需求。
  2. 智能排序:自动整理依赖顺序,帮助开发者遵循最佳实践,增强代码整洁度。
  3. Maven到Gradle无缝迁移:独特的特性,允许开发者直接粘贴Maven依赖并自动转换为Gradle格式,减少了跨生态系统的转换障碍。
  4. 高效集成:直接集成进IDEA的工作流,通过快捷键快速执行操作,无需离开当前编辑环境。
  5. 持续更新与维护:项目持续升级,解决了包括空指针异常在内的多个实际问题,并不断新增功能以满足用户需求。

综上所述,Gradle dependencies formatter是任何依赖于Gradle且注重代码质量和开发效率团队的必备工具。它的存在不仅简化了日常开发中的繁琐工作,而且促进了项目的标准化,是提升团队生产力的秘密武器。无论是个人开发者还是企业级项目,它都值得你去尝试和信赖。立即安装,体验依赖管理的丝滑之旅吧!

idea-gradle-dependencies-formatterGradle dependencies formatter for IntelliJ IDEA项目地址:https://gitcode.com/gh_mirrors/id/idea-gradle-dependencies-formatter

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

薛靓璐Gifford

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值